Many years: It is a slow process, taking upwards of 10 years. Most people with GERD never develop Barrets

Varies: Gerd of some sort is in 10-20% of the population (maybe slightly higher). Barretts' is about 1/10th that common http://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ed/16344051 so... most never get it.

Chemical burn: Reflux, chemically burns the lining mucosa of the esophagus.......which is not acid resistant. Recurrent and prolonged process changes this epithelium to abnormal.....Barret's
